LiDAR (Light Detection and Ranging) technology is a remote sensing method that uses light in the form of a pulsed laser to measure variable distances to the Earth. The purpose of LiDAR technology is to create high-resolution maps, measure terrain features, and collect data for various applications like urban planning, forestry, archaeology, and autonomous vehicles.

The advantages of LiDAR technology include high accuracy, ability to penetrate dense vegetation, and capability to generate detailed 3D models. This technology can also be used for disaster response, environmental monitoring, and infrastructure development.

Market Trends in the LiDAR technology Market


- Miniaturization of LiDAR sensors: Advances in technology are enabling smaller, lighter LiDAR sensors, allowing for easier integration into various devices such as drones and autonomous vehicles.

- Increase in adoption of solid-state LiDAR: Solid-state LiDAR offers lower cost, smaller size, and higher reliability compared to traditional mechanical LiDAR systems, leading to its increasing adoption in the market.

- Rise of automotive LiDAR applications: With the growth of autonomous vehicles, the automotive industry is driving the demand for LiDAR technology for enhanced safety and navigation features.

- Integration of LiDAR with other sensors: Combining LiDAR with other sensing technologies, such as cameras and radar, is becoming a popular trend to improve overall system accuracy and efficiency.

- Industry disruptions and partnerships: Collaboration between LiDAR manufacturers, software developers, and industry players is leading to disruptive innovations and new market opportunities.

LiDAR technology comes in various forms such as Aerial Lidar, Ground-based Lidar, Mobile Lidar, and UAV Lidar. Aerial Lidar is used for mapping large areas from aircraft, Ground-based Lidar provides high-resolution scans on the ground, Mobile Lidar is mounted on vehicles for efficient data collection, and UAV Lidar is utilized for remote and inaccessible areas. LiDAR technology is utilized in various applications such as coastal monitoring (shoreline changes), transportation (mapping roads and bridges), forestry (surveying vegetation), infrastructure (urban planning), defense and aerospace (target detection), transmission lines (monitoring power lines), flood mapping (predicting and preparing for floods), exploration (surveying for mineral deposits), and driverless cars (obstacle detection). The fastest growing application segment in terms of revenue is driverless cars, due to increased focus on automation and safety in the automotive industry. LiDAR technology is used in these applications by emitting laser pulses and measuring the time it takes for them to bounce back, creating detailed 3D maps of the surroundings.
